1209 in Roman Numerals
The number 1209 is written MCCIX in Roman numerals. Reading left to right and adding the values gives 1000 + 100 + 100 + 9 = 1209. Roman numerals use seven letters — I (1), V (5), X (10), L (50), C (100), D (500) and M (1000) — with a smaller letter before a larger one meaning subtraction (IV = 4, IX = 9, XL = 40, XC = 90, CD = 400, CM = 900).

Is there a Roman numeral for zero?
No. The Roman system has no symbol for zero, which is one reason it was eventually replaced for calculation.
